Output defb88730633cfaa5f29b45118ecea79d53e5be42de837775892f82755e5320f:1

value
520496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8cfef1b98604f97e3f2fccf16f5dd8285b5110a OP_EQUAL
address
3Nv1nZG9NH6z2z6RcqRfE3qaSPn6EehMw8
transaction
defb88730633cfaa5f29b45118ecea79d53e5be42de837775892f82755e5320f
spent
true